Strict observance of the timeframes necessary to ensure in-depth inspections of each component.
General installation check-up, trial run and performance test of a fire extinguishing system to ensure its complete suitability. A technical report is also issued.
Complete check-up on the efficiency of a system via an exclusive process and use of specific professional equipment. A predictive report is then issued on potential future problems.
Constant specialist support available for immediate pinpointing of breakdowns/malfunctions, with an option to work on repairs while allowing operations to continue by providing an auxiliary fire extinguishing system in the interim.
Warranty provided on the availability of any original component through direct access to GEI’s Manufacturing Partners’ warehouses.
Solving particularly complex problems safely by sending specialised technical personnel, anywhere in the country.
Constant remote system monitoring. A device designed using innovative technology that can be installed on any pre-existing fire extinguishing system, without having to rely on traditional wiring.
Personalised sessions intended to raise awareness about the importance of fire extinguishing systems and their correct functioning, aiming to help understand what a maintenance worker actually does.
Surveying a particular site to allow for refitting research on a pre-existing system. A technical and economic report is then issued with a recommended design solution, including an estimated timeline and projected costs.
A theoretical and practical training course, including shadowing days in the field geared towards teaching the necessary maintenance skills to carry out the weekly surveillance process on the fire extinguishing system. A qualification certificate is issued at the end.
